Compartilhar via


Funções do acessador de vetor da Biblioteca DirectXMath

Lista as funções de acessador de vetor fornecidas pela Biblioteca DirectXMath.

Os acessadores de vetor DirectXMath permitem que os desenvolvedores escrevam código que obtém e define componentes individuais de um vetor de maneira portátil e ideal.

Nesta seção

Tópico Descrição
XMVectorGetByIndex
Recupere o valor de um dos quatro componentes de um tipo de dados XMVECTOR que contém dados de ponto flutuante por índice.
XMVectorGetByIndexPtr
Recupere, em uma instância de um ponto flutuante referenciado por ponteiro, o valor de um dos quatro componentes de um tipo de dados XMVECTOR que contém dados de ponto flutuante, referenciados por índice.
XMVectorGetIntByIndex
Recupere o valor de um dos quatro componentes de um tipo de dados XMVECTOR que contém dados inteiros por índice.
XMVectorGetIntByIndexPtr
Recupere, em uma instância de um inteiro referenciado por ponteiro, o valor de um dos quatro componentes de um tipo de dados XMVECTOR que contém dados inteiros por índice.
XMVectorGetIntW
Recupere o w componente de um tipo de dados XMVECTOR.
XMVectorGetIntWPtr
Recupera o componente de um tipo de dados XMVECTOR que contém dados inteiros e armazena o w valor desse componente em uma instância de uint32_t referenciada por um ponteiro.
XMVectorGetIntX
Recupere o x componente de um tipo de dados XMVECTOR.
XMVectorGetIntXPtr
Recupera o componente de um tipo de dados XMVECTOR que contém dados inteiros e armazena o x valor desse componente em uma instância de uint32_t referenciada por um ponteiro.
XMVectorGetInty
Recupere o y componente de um tipo de dados XMVECTOR.
XMVectorGetIntYPtr
Recupera o componente de um tipo de dados XMVECTOR que contém dados inteiros e armazena o y valor desse componente em uma instância de uint32_t referenciada por um ponteiro.
XMVectorGetIntZ
Recupere o z componente de um tipo de dados XMVECTOR.
XMVectorGetIntZPtr
Recupera o componente de um tipo de dados XMVECTOR que contém dados inteiros e armazena o z valor desse componente em uma instância de uint32_t referenciada por um ponteiro.
XMVectorGetW
Recupere o w componente de um tipo de dados XMVECTOR.
XMVectorGetWPtr
Recupere o w componente de um tipo de dados XMVECTOR que contém dados de ponto flutuante e armazene o valor desse componente em uma instância de float referenciada por um ponteiro.
XMVectorGetX
Recupere o x componente de um tipo de dados XMVECTOR.
XMVectorGetXPtr
Recupere o x componente de um tipo de dados XMVECTOR que contém dados de ponto flutuante e armazene o valor desse componente em uma instância de float referenciada por um ponteiro.
XMVectorGetY
Recupere o y componente de um tipo de dados XMVECTOR.
XMVectorGetYPtr
Recupere o y componente de um tipo de dados XMVECTOR que contém dados de ponto flutuante e armazene o valor desse componente em uma instância de float referenciada por um ponteiro.
XMVectorGetZ
Recupere o z componente de um tipo de dados XMVECTOR.
XMVectorGetZPtr
Recupere o z componente de um tipo de dados XMVECTOR que contém dados de ponto flutuante e armazene o valor desse componente em uma instância de float referenciada por um ponteiro.
XMVectorSetByIndex
Use um objeto de ponto flutuante para definir o valor de um dos quatro componentes de um tipo de dados XMVECTOR que contém dados inteiros referenciados por um índice.
XMVectorSetByIndexPtr
Use um ponteiro para uma instância de ponto flutuante para definir o valor de um dos quatro componentes de um tipo de dados XMVECTOR que contém dados de ponto flutuante referenciados por um índice.
XMVectorSetIntByIndex
Use uma instância de inteiro para definir o valor de um dos quatro componentes de um tipo de dados XMVECTOR que contém dados inteiros referenciados por um índice.
XMVectorSetIntByIndexPtr
Use um ponteiro para uma instância de inteiro para definir o valor de um dos quatro componentes de um tipo de dados XMVECTOR que contém dados inteiros referenciados por um índice.
XMVectorSetIntW
Defina o valor do w componente de um tipo de dados XMVECTOR.
XMVectorSetIntWPtr
Define o w componente de um XMVECTOR que contém dados inteiros, com um valor contido em uma instância de uint32_t referenciado por um ponteiro.
XMVectorSetIntX
Defina o valor do x componente de um tipo de dados XMVECTOR.
XMVectorSetIntXPtr
Define o x componente de um XMVECTOR que contém dados inteiros, com um valor contido em uma instância de uint32_t referenciado por um ponteiro.
XMVectorSetIntY
Defina o valor do y componente de um tipo de dados XMVECTOR.
XMVectorSetIntYPtr
Define o y componente de um XMVECTOR que contém dados inteiros, com um valor contido em uma instância de uint32_t referenciado por um ponteiro.
XMVectorSetIntZ
Defina o valor do z componente de um tipo de dados XMVECTOR.
XMVectorSetIntZPtr
Define o z componente de um XMVECTOR que contém dados inteiros, com um valor contido em uma instância de uint32_t referenciado por um ponteiro.
XMVectorSetW
Defina o valor do w componente de um tipo de dados XMVECTOR.
XMVectorSetWPtr
Define o w componente de um XMVECTOR que contém dados de ponto flutuante, com um valor contido em uma instância de float referenciada por um ponteiro .
XMVectorSetX
Defina o valor do x componente de um tipo de dados XMVECTOR.
XMVectorSetXPtr
Define o x componente de um XMVECTOR que contém dados de ponto flutuante, com um valor contido em uma instância de float referenciada por um ponteiro .
XMVectorSetY
Defina o valor do y componente de um tipo de dados XMVECTOR.
XMVectorSetYPtr
Define o y componente de um XMVECTOR que contém dados de ponto flutuante, com um valor contido em uma instância de float referenciada por um ponteiro .
XMVectorSetZ
Defina o valor do z componente de um tipo de dados XMVECTOR.
XMVectorSetZPtr
Define o z componente de um XMVECTOR que contém dados de ponto flutuante, com um valor contido em uma instância de float referenciada por um ponteiro .

 

Funções da biblioteca DirectXMath